As he puts himself through injury rehabilitation once again, Riccardo Calafiori has been spotted amongst a few movie stars on the red carpet during the week.

The Arsenal star has been out of action since he suffered a knee issue against Shakhtar Donetsk in the Champions League.

Calafiori has been injured since, though Mikel Arteta will be hopeful that the star is back in the squad after the international break.

With some big games coming up, the defender will be putting himself through the paces to return to action – having missed out on the latest Italy squad through that injury.

In his time off, Calafiori has been rather busy not just recovering, but featuring on the red carpet at a huge movie premiere.

Riccardo Calafiori spotted at Gladiator 2 global film premiere

During his time away from the pitch, Calafiori was spotted in London in Leicester Square as part of a huge movie premiere.

The star was invited to see a screening of Gladiator II on Wednesday, November 13, which was part of the Royal Film Performance & Global Premiere for the movie.

Spotted on the red carpet, the defender was snapped dressed up in a suit in front of all the decorative sets to celebrate the release of the film.

Arsenal posted a photo of the star on Instagram with the caption: “Richy 🤝 The Royal Film Performance and Global Premiere of Gladiator II.”

It marks some decent rest time for Calafiori, who will be looking to use the two-week break to full effect before an intense run of fixtures.

Riccardo Calafiori injury return hope

Recent reports stated that Calafiori could be out of just one-to-two weeks through injury following the Shakhtar Donetsk clash.

With that time frame passing, there is increased hope that the versatile star will be back in action for the coming run of matches.

The return from the international break comes against an in-form Nottingham Forest side that could leapfrog Arsenal with victory.

After that comes yet more Premier League, Champions League and EFL Cup action that will test the squad at every avenue.
